Ever since I upgraded to Vista, I am no longer able to view thumbnail images for all my .psd files, only the default psd icon. I can't see them in explorer, or when using the File > Open viewer. I have no problems with thumbnails for my Paint Shop Pro images (pspimage). Is there a way to get the psd thumbnails working again? I'm running PS CS2 on Vista Home Premium.
